Of the three, lotrimin, lamisil (terbinafine) and micatin, which is the best for treating scalp fungus?

Tinea capitis: If the fungal infection is more widespread and deeper, you may need to take oral antifungals. I have found that for tinea capitis topical antifungals usually do not help and so i usually tend to prescribe oral antifungal instead of wasting time during which time the infection will spread further.
